Buying rental in the Catskills and Adirondacks

Yamin Hossain
  • Controller/Finance
  • Elmhurst, NY
Posted

Hello all,

Just trying to get some insight here. I'm looking to buy land in the Adirondacks or Catskills and build a container home (40' Containers x 6). Would be used as a rental. 

I've hit a dilemma, should I spend more money on property and purchase a Waterfront/Lakefront lot? Is it worth it? Should I get land that has only views (open mountain views)?

I've done a bit of legwork and see that houses that are lakefront/waterfront are being booked more frequently compared to homes that have a mountain view. The price difference of waterfront vs openview is about 50K-80K.

Would love to hear what you guys think.
